Replacing the Gateway 200ARC Keyboard

www.gateway.com

Replacing the Gateway 200ARC 
Keyboard

This package includes a replacement keyboard for your Gateway 200ARC 
notebook and these printed instructions.

Tools you need

You need a small Phillips and a small flat-blade screwdriver to replace the 
keyboard.

Preventing static electricity discharge

The components inside your notebook are extremely sensitive to static 
electricity, also known as electrostatic discharge (ESD).

Before replacing the keyboard, follow these guidelines:

Turn off your notebook.

Wear a grounding wrist strap (available at most electronics stores) and 
attach it to a bare metal part of your workbench or other grounded 
connection.

Touch a bare metal surface on your workbench or other grounded object.

Warning

ESD can permanently damage electrostatic 
discharge-sensitive components in your notebook. 
Prevent ESD damage by following ESD guidelines every 
time you replace the keyboard.

Warning

To avoid exposure to dangerous electrical voltages and 
moving parts, turn off your notebook and unplug the power 
cord and modem and network cables and remove the 
battery before opening the case.

Warning

To prevent risk of electric shock, do not insert any object 
into the vent holes of the notebook.
